How to Set Up and Manage Comments in WordPress
WordPress provides native comment management tools, but most users prefer adding anti-spam plugins to maintain site security and performance.

Community Q&A
How do I enable comments on my WordPress site?
Navigate to Settings > Discussion in your WordPress dashboard and check the box labeled ‘Allow people to submit comments on new posts’.
Can I disable comments for specific posts?
Yes, you can disable comments on individual posts by editing the post and unchecking ‘Allow comments’ in the Discussion meta box.
How do I prevent spam in WordPress comments?
You can enable comment moderation in Settings > Discussion or install dedicated anti-spam plugins like Akismet to filter out unwanted content.
